What Is Microneedling?

Also called collagen induction therapy, microneedling creates thousands of tiny channels in the skin. This controlled injury activates wound healing, resulting in firmer, smoother, more youthful-looking skin over time.

How Does Microneedling Work?

After applying topical numbing, your provider glides a pen-like device across your skin. Fine needles oscillate rapidly, creating microscopic channels. These trigger growth factor release and collagen production over the following weeks.

Microneedling FAQs for Short Hills Residents

1 When will I see results from microneedling?

Initial glow is visible within days. Collagen remodeling occurs over 4-6 weeks, with continued improvement for 3-6 months after a treatment series. Consult a Short Hills provider for personalized guidance.

2 What is the difference between microneedling at home vs professional?

Professional devices use longer needles (1-3mm vs 0.25mm) and reach deeper skin layers. Home rollers provide minimal benefit compared to professional treatments. Your Short Hills provider can give specific recommendations.

3 What should I put on my face after microneedling?

Use gentle, hydrating products like hyaluronic acid serum. Avoid retinoids, vitamin C, and active acids for 48-72 hours. Always follow your provider's aftercare instructions. Short Hills practitioners are trained in current best practices.

4 Is microneedling painful?

With proper numbing cream applied 30-45 minutes before treatment, most patients find microneedling tolerable—described as sandpaper-like sensation.

5 Can I wear makeup after microneedling?

Avoid makeup for at least 24 hours post-treatment. When you resume, use clean mineral makeup. Your provider will give specific aftercare instructions. Short Hills med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.

6 What is the downtime after microneedling?

Expect redness similar to a sunburn for 24-72 hours. Most patients feel comfortable returning to work the next day with mineral makeup. Consult a Short Hills provider for personalized guidance.

7 Who should not get microneedling?

Avoid microneedling if you have active acne, eczema, psoriasis, or skin infections. Those on blood thinners or with keloid scarring should consult their provider. Your Short Hills provider can give specific recommendations.
